Navigating Cancer Treatment: Advances and Challenges

The landscape of cancer therapy is continuously evolving, with groundbreaking breakthroughs offering renewed hope for patients. From targeted therapies that precisely attack cancerous cells to innovative cancer immunology that harness the body's own defenses, medical science is making strides in fighting this formidable condition. However, despite these remarkable advances, navigating the complexities of cancer treatment remains a difficult journey for patients and their families.

  • Adverse reactions from treatment can be severe, impacting both physical and emotional well-being.
  • The economic impact of cancer therapy can be staggering, leading to financial strain.
  • Access to care can also pose a obstacle for some patients, depending on their insurance coverage.

Therefore, it is essential to embrace a holistic approach to cancer therapy, one that not only addresses the medical aspects but also considers the mental health needs of patients and their loved ones.

Strategies for Diabetes Prevention: Empowering You

Diabetes prevention starts with a commitment that empowers individuals to take charge of their health. By understanding the elements that contribute to diabetes development, individuals can implement powerful strategies to mitigate their risk. These strategies often involve making sustainable lifestyle changes such as maintaining a nutritious diet, engaging in regular physical activity, and monitoring stress levels.

  • Talking to healthcare professionals can provide valuable support on personalized diabetes prevention plans.
  • Educating oneself, including family history, can help reveal potential vulnerabilities.
  • Adopting gradual lifestyle changes is often more effective than drastic overhauls.

Keep in mind that diabetes prevention is a continuous journey that requires dedication and determination. By adopting these strategies, individuals can empower themselves to live healthier, more fulfilling lives.

The Influence of Chronic Illnesses on Healthcare|

Chronic diseases pose a substantial burden to public health systems globally. These conditions, characterized by long-duration and often progressive manifestations, place immense demand on healthcare resources. The incidence of chronic diseases is growing at an alarming rate, driven by factors such as aging populations, lifestyle changes, and advancements in medical science. This heightened prevalence has significant implications for healthcare systems, including increased costs, overburdened facilities, and a deficiency of skilled healthcare professionals. Addressing the impact of chronic diseases requires a multi-faceted approach that encompasses treatment, improved access to care, and sustainable health systems.

Addressing Chronic Disease through Lifestyle Interventions

Chronic diseases are a significant weight on individuals and healthcare systems worldwide. These conditions, such as heart disease, diabetes, and cancer, often arise from a combination of genetic predisposition and lifestyle factors. Fortunately, promising evidence suggests that lifestyle interventions can play a crucial role in preventing and managing chronic diseases.

A comprehensive approach to lifestyle modifications encompasses various key areas. Firstly, adopting a nutritious di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and whole grains is essential. Secondly, regular physical activity, targeting at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ise per week, can significantly reduce the risk of chronic disease.

Moreover, managing stress through techniques such as yoga or meditation can have a profound impact on overall health. Adequate sleep is also crucial for balancing bodily functions and enhancing the immune system.

By implementing these lifestyle changes, individuals can empower themselves to reduce the risk of chronic disease and promote long-term well-being. Furthermore, healthcare professionals can play a vital role in guiding patients towards sustainable lifestyle modifications and providing ongoing support.
